COP- Community Outreach Program
Our Community Outreach Program (COP) is designed to focus on gaining a relationship between the Lycoming Regional Police Department and the communities it serves. By Interacting with our communities in various ways and developing strong relationships, we can build a mutual trust. When that trust is built, we can reduce crime, decrease the fear of crime, and make our communities safe and vibrant for everyone.
The COP was re-established in January of 2023 when Old Lycoming Police Department and Tiadaghton Regional Police Department merged, forming the new Lycoming Regional Police Department. This program is made up of officers within the department who strive to connect with the communities and promote the safety on our streets. The Lycoming Regional Police Department community outreach strategy enables our officers to engage directly with neighborhood associations, faith-based agencies, nonprofit organizations, and local residents to develop positive relationships with federal, state and local law enforcement and judicial agencies, with the ultimate goal to collaborate on strategies to defend the interests and rights of our citizens.
